I have several sneakers in my collection. For the ones I got in the eighties, the pvc midsole crumbles as it gets powdery with age. For those I got in the 90s and 2000 up, it's the adhesive that disintegrates so that the midsole, outsole and uppers get separated. These Nike, Adidas, Puma, Asics, New Balance shoes have not been used at all. Is there any way to preserve them? I just like collecting them and keeping them in boxes with those little silica gel pouches.
